> I'm currently in the process of trying to develop a data archive storage
> system for GPS data that is being received, and needs to be stored in
> real-time.
>
> The storage doesn't seem to be that big of a problem. The problem comes
> when we have applications that also need to be able to read that data in
> real-time. I've been reading the documentation and doing some
> experimenting but haven't succeeded in coming up with a workable
> implementation.
>
> First, doing a reopen where compression is involved has resulted in
> decompression errors. That's not overly surprising but it'd be nice to
> be able to support compression and data following (along the same lines
> as tail -f) at the same time if at all possible.
>
> Second, when I did do a reopen, I still never saw any of the new data
> updates. Is the only way I'm going to be able to achieve this by
> closing and opening the file again, or is there a smarter way to do this?
>
> Third, I'm using packet tables of compound data objects, due to the
> complexity of the data being stored.
>
> Here's a bit of the code that I've been trying to implement (hopefully
> it's not excessive for the list):
Currently, the HDF5 library doesn't support multiple processes
accessing the same file, where 1+ of those processes is writing/modifying the
file. We are going to have some form of single-writer/multiple-reader access
in the next major release, but it's still too early to make snapshots of this
feature for external testing.
